[ilasm] Don't break arguments compatiblity
[mono-project.git] / mcs / tests / test-865.cs
blob62beace6ce64254c97fa6444c33948519d909b97
1 class C
3 public static void Main ()
5 Create (false);
8 static IA Create (bool arg)
10 // Verifier issue
11 IA runner = arg ? new B2 () : (IA) new B1 ();
12 return runner;
16 interface IA
21 class B2 : IA
25 class B1 : B
29 class B : IA